| /** |
| * Tool for getting configuration information from a configuration file. |
| * |
| * Adding more options: |
| * <ul> |
| * <li> |
| * If adding a simple option to get a value corresponding to a key in the |
| * configuration, use regular {@link GetConf.CommandHandler}. |
| * See {@link GetConf.Command#EXCLUDE_FILE} example. |
| * </li> |
| * <li> |
| * If adding an option that is does not return a value for a key, add |
| * a subclass of {@link GetConf.CommandHandler} and set it up in |
| * {@link GetConf.Command}. |
| * |
| * See {@link GetConf.Command#NAMENODE} for example. |
| * |
| * Add for the new option added, a map entry with the corresponding |
| * {@link GetConf.CommandHandler}. |
| * </ul> |
| */ |
| public class GetConf extends Configured implements Tool { |
| private static final String DESCRIPTION = "hdfs getconf is utility for " |
| + "getting configuration information from the config file.\n"; |
| |
| enum Command { |
| NAMENODE("-namenodes", "gets list of namenodes in the cluster."), |
| SECONDARY("-secondaryNameNodes", |
| "gets list of secondary namenodes in the cluster."), |
| BACKUP("-backupNodes", "gets list of backup nodes in the cluster."), |
| INCLUDE_FILE("-includeFile", |
| "gets the include file path that defines the datanodes " + |
| "that can join the cluster."), |
| EXCLUDE_FILE("-excludeFile", |
| "gets the exclude file path that defines the datanodes " + |
| "that need to decommissioned."), |
| NNRPCADDRESSES("-nnRpcAddresses", "gets the namenode rpc addresses"), |
| CONFKEY("-confKey [key]", "gets a specific key from the configuration"); |
